Multiplayer Desynchronization

I did not see any other post about this, but excuse me if there is. I have played the original sins with a friend of mine for some time, and now we have played entrenchment twice together. Both times we have played, we seem to experience a de-sync at a somewhat random point. It usually happens right around the epitome of technology and when we've placed numerous starbases (leave us alone, we like turtling). There is no warning of this desynchronization, we just suddenly figure out that we are no longer quite on the same page as one of us rushes to defend the other and they have no idea why.

When it happens, we both continue playing none the wiser, but seemingly in our own individual worlds. For example, I will have taken over half of the map and on my screen my ally is either laying around doing nothing or making pitiful attempts to attack. Then one of us will ask each other why the other isn't doing anything, and it turns out they have already taken over half of the map themselves, and it is the other person getting destroyed/sitting around. Very odd. This has never happened before the beta, so I can only imagine that is the culprit.

The same thing happened to us.  A friend and I were playing against 2 AIs.  Somewhere along the way the game got desynced and my friend got ahead time wise.  He would say that an enemy fleet was attacking him and a few minutes later it would show up.

When he attacked a planet and colonized it I was still in the middle of attacking it.  He colonized it with his progenitor and I colonized it with my Junra (I think that's what they are called).  However, when I built a capitol ship yard in my version it showed up in his as being owned by him, however it had the model for my race's (vasari, I think) capitol ship yard and not his (the advent).  We could trade resources with each other but the bounty was off.  It was pretty crazy.

So you say these desyncs happened in the Entrenchment beta?

Your best bet, if you have them consistently, is to email [email protected] and let them know that you can get consistent desyncs, and ask for what settings to change in your user.setting file for the game to spit out sync logs that you can email back (both you and your friend) so they can track the cause.

They'll walk you through how to set up the logging and such.
